Waimea

Hot and sunny than the other areas on the island, Waimea is warm in the summer and hot in the winter. The area is rural and not without historical significance. It is the area where Captain James Cook first discovered the Hawaiian Islands in 1778, the area where the first missionaries settled and it was a thriving plantation town that produced sugar. Today taro and other crops are cultivated and harvested. Waimea is the gateway to the awesome Waimea Canyon and Kokee. Located upland of Waimea, this area is filled with beautiful overlooks, hiking trails and more.
